Thick Film Printer Technician – Level 1

Lockwood Industries, LLC dba FralockPoway, CA
$20 - $25Onsite

About The Position

We are seeking an energetic and detail-oriented Thick Film Printer Technician - Level 1 to join our growing technical manufacturing team. In this entry-level role, you will work closely with senior technicians and production staff to perform routine printer operations, material staging, and basic preventative maintenance tasks. This is a hands-on opportunity to build your technical skills in precision screen printing, support daily manufacturing output, and contribute to a clean, safe, and efficient production environment.

Responsibilities

  • Assist with basic machine loading, substrate staging, and operating semi-automated thick film screen printers under direct supervision.
  • Prepare, mix, and stage conductive/resistive Inks following strict recipes; assist with screen cleaning, reclamation, and proper storage.
  • Perform visual inspections of printed substrates under magnification to check for obvious flaws, smearing, or misalignments, reporting defects immediately to senior staff.
  • Perform scheduled basic housekeeping and routine preventative maintenance tasks on printing platforms and cleanroom equipment.
  • Accurately log production counts, lot numbers, traveler sign-offs, and scrap data into the manufacturing execution system (MES) or ERP platform.
  • Participate in plant 5S, cleanroom housekeeping, and Lean manufacturing initiatives to keep the print area organized, safe, and contamination-free.
  • Strictly comply with all safety rules, chemical handling guidelines, ESD (electrostatic discharge) protocols, cleanroom regulations, and pro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) usage.
